MATERIALS --------- **Yarns:** This pattern uses 7 different colorways of acrylic, worsted-weight yarn: one main color (MC) and six contrasting colors (CC) across 2 different yarn lines. Worsted—[Basic Stitch® Anti Pilling™ Yarn][6] in 4 colorways: Ecru (MC), Sage (CC1), Baby Pink (CC2), and Cedarwood (CC3) * 100% Acrylic * 185 yds (170 m) per 3.5 oz (100 g) skein * Find this yarn on [lionbrand.com][7] or visit [yarnsub.com][8] to find comparable substitutes available in your region. Worsted—[Lion Brand Heartland][9] in 3 colorways: Channel Islands (CC4), North Cascades (CC5), and Congaree (CC6) * 100% Acrylic * 251 yds (230 m) per 5 oz (142 g) skein * Find this yarn on [lionbrand.com][10] or visit [yarnsub.com][11] to find comparable substitutes available in your region. **Yardage Required:** 7 skeins or 1115 yds (1020 m) of MC 1 skein or 165 yds (151 m) of each CC **Yarn Substitution:** Substitute [Basic Stitch® Anti Pilling™ Yarn][12] or [Lion Brand Heartland][13] with any similar worsted weight (category #4) yarn that matches gauge. **Hook:** Size U.S. 7 (4.5 mm) or size needed to obtain gauge **Notions:** Tapestry needle, scissors GAUGE ----- 4 x 4” (10 x 10 cm) = approximately 13.5 dc and 7 rows, blocked. FINISHED MEASUREMENTS --------------------- Finished blanket measures approximately 43.5” (110 cm) wide and 57.5” (146 cm) long, blocked. Each square measures approximately 14” (36 cm) square, blocked. TERMS + ABBREVIATIONS --------------------- *Written in U.S. Crochet Terms* **CC:** contrasting color **ch(s):** chain(s) **ch-sp:** chain space **dc:** double crochet **hdc:** half double crochet **MC:** main color (shown in Ecru) **rep:** repeat **rnd(s):** round(s) **sc:** single crochet **sl st:** slip stitch **st(s):** stitch(es) **tch:** turning chain PATTERN NOTES ------------- **Skill Level:** Easy **Sizing:** This blanket is written in one size. If you would like to alter the measurements of the blanket, you can do so by working fewer or additional rounds to each of your squares, or by working additional or fewer squares than worked in this sample. **Stitch Counts:** Stitch counts are listed after each round. A full stitch count chart can be found at the bottom of the next page. **Right Side/Wrong Side:** The right side is the side facing you as you crochet the very last round of each square. **Turning Chain:** The turning chain (ch-3) counts as the first double crochet of each round. **Construction:** This blanket is worked in twelve concentric squares that are later joined together using a crochet hook. A simple border is worked last around the perimeter to complete the blanket. **Changing Colors:** When changing colors, work the last stitch of the round with the old color, but do not work the final yarn-over to close the stitch. Work this yarn-over with the new color. Then drop the old color, leaving a tail long enough to weave in. You are also welcome to complete your round using your old color, then join your new color to any corner chain space with a standing stitch, if preferred.
